The YAML binding schema for renesas,r9a09g047-xspi requires four clocks (ah= b, axi, spi, spix2) and two resets (hresetn, aresetn), but only two clocks and one reset are provided here. Because device tree schema lists match positionally by index, providing spi at index 1 of clock-names violates the schema that expects axi at that position, which will cause dtbs_check to fail.
